Every year a Lyme Disease Advisory Committee of around 10 people advises the state about Lyme awareness and advocacy.

This year's meeting is Friday March 16 in Sacramento, at the CA Public Health Dept, 1615 Capitol Ave, at one end of the Capitol Mall.

The meeting runs from 9:30am - 3:30pm, with a lunch break. The public listens to the discussion, can make remarks on specific agenda items, then make general remarks at the end of the day.

It's a great way to find out what the state is doing, have some input and meet Lyme folks from around the state.

The annual Sacramento meeting of the Lyme Disease Advisory Committee will be Friday, March 16. If you are close enough to come, it would be great to have you in the audience. (A good crowd shows state officials that people care about this topic.) Another option is to listen in by phone. At the end of the meeting, there is an opportunity for public comment, typically limited to 3 minutes each. Agenda and call in info is posted below.

If you can come in person, here are a few items of note: If you drive, allow time to find parking in one of the public garages/lots in the area. You'll have to pay for parking and walk a few blocks. The meeting breaks for lunch. There are a number of casual lunch spots (sandwiches, salad, Chinese food) within a few blocks of the meeting place. If the weather is nice, you could also picnic on a bench at nearby Capitol Park.
